I'm fine with 1-10. If there's this magic $10 price for institutions, we'll be above that. If there's not, then it doesn't really matter. It'll be nice to have earnings reported at a level that's "countable".

In the end, it's just a blip. The key is going to be whether sales and profitability continue to improve. That's what will drive the price higher regardless of whether it's at $1.20 or $12 or $120. Personally, I think it's time now to see some real revenue growth that flows to the bottom line.

My experience with reverse splits has not been good. The threat of the reverse split has been having a negative effect on this stock since it was first rumored. Every time the stock had a positive run the rumor would circulate, and you know the results.

You can see the results now that it is a fact. Hope for the best but prepare for IIP to be under $10 per share after the reverse split.

Volatility will be up after the reverse split, and we could see some big jumps up in price as positive earnings are released, but don't expect funds to jump on this one until Internap gets finished selling new shares. I expect them to issue new shares to reward themselves, and settle debt, ETC.
